The contest is over and we have no winner...didn't even have any guessers!
The TV commercial was for Burger King. Robbie Rist played Hubble Q. Hubble, walked up to the counter, raised his finger and said "Double Meat! Double Meat!" The commmercial was for a double hamburger they were selling at the time. It wasn't the double cheeseburger, although that may have been what it evolved into...unless they already had that sandwich!
